首页
/ Orama项目首页空白问题分析与解决方案

Orama项目首页空白问题分析与解决方案

2025-05-25 20:20:07作者:姚月梅Lane

问题现象

在Orama开源项目的网站首页中,用户发现页面内容显示为空白状态。经过技术团队排查,确认这是由于iframe组件加载失败导致的显示异常。iframe请求的CDN资源返回空内容,造成页面关键元素无法正常渲染。

技术分析

iframe作为网页中嵌入其他内容的常用技术手段,其加载失败通常由以下几个原因导致:

  1. 资源路径错误:iframe引用的外部资源URL可能配置不正确
  2. 跨域限制:浏览器安全策略阻止了跨域资源的加载
  3. CDN问题:内容分发网络可能出现临时故障或资源被移除
  4. HTTPS混合内容:安全页面加载非安全内容时被浏览器阻止

在本案例中,经过开发者排查确认,问题根源在于iframe请求的CDN资源实际上并不包含有效内容,导致渲染失败。

解决方案

技术团队快速响应并修复了该问题,主要采取了以下措施:

  1. 检查iframe组件的资源引用路径
  2. 验证CDN资源的可用性
  3. 更新为有效的资源地址或备用方案
  4. 添加错误处理机制,增强容错能力

经验总结

这个案例提醒开发者:

  1. 对于关键页面元素,应当实现备用渲染方案
  2. 定期检查外部依赖资源的可用性
  3. 在前端代码中加入完善的错误处理逻辑
  4. 建立自动化监控机制,及时发现页面异常

通过这次问题的快速定位和解决,Orama项目团队展现了良好的技术响应能力,也为其他开发者提供了宝贵的实战经验。

登录后查看全文
热门项目推荐
相关项目推荐

项目优选

收起